The View will appear across the UK for four special DJ gigs at the This Feeling club nights later this month.

The band, who are currently in the initial stages of recording a new album, will be the guests of This Feeling at Edinburgh’s Voodoo Rooms tomorrow night (April 4th), the Record Factory in Glasgow on April 5th,  London’s Queen Of Hoxton (April 12th) and finally the Sheffield Leadmill on April 19th.

The View were last active studio-wise back in 2012 with their fourth album ‘Cheeky For a Reason‘, of which our review concluded:

“In the lead up to this release, The View likened ‘Cheeky For a Reason‘ to Fleetwood Mac. For the most part – and for better or worse – it’s a fairly misleading comparison. The exception to this rule is ‘The Clock‘; a dark slow burner that lies somewhere between ‘Dreams‘ and ‘Rhiannon‘. Unsurprisingly, it’s the most mature sounding song on the album, and a worthy new direction if the band so choose.”
